Job Description:

Purpose:
The Production Deck Operator is responsible for various tasks related to the preparation and processing of production batches under the guidance of the Deck Lead.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Prepare packaging materials for production batches.
  • Add dry and solvent materials to production batches as required.
  • Sample materials and deliver them to the lab for testing.
  • Accurately fill containers to the specified weights as indicated on batch tickets.
  • Create and affix appropriate labels to packaging containers.
  • Move finished products to the warehouse (FG1 location).
  • Complete applicable sections of batch sheets.
  • Maintain cleanliness and order in the deck tank area.
  • Perform any additional tasks as assigned by the Deck Lead.

Equipment Used:

  • Forklift
  • Deck Mixers
  • Label Printer
  • Filters
